Description I always wondered if Maine was really in control when he attacked other Freelancers for their AI, or if it was the AI who were controlling him.

With Sigma in his head, i highly doubt Maine is willing to do his dirty work. Even if Maine is a brute and a bit egotistical, I don't think he has it in him to attack his comrades without some driving force, IE Sigma.

While this is an excellent piece of work, I must disagree with your interpretation of the Meta's rampage. First off, let me point out that the Meta is my favorite villain of the show, and is tied with Caboose with my favorite character overall.

That said

Even without Sigma in his head, the Meta pursued the reds and blues in hopes of recovering Epsilon, which was in Caboose's possession, and the moment he got his hands on Epsilon Tex, he turned on Wash and attempted to kill him and the others.

The statement "We are the Meta" clearly shows a personal view of being a singular entity made up of numerous parts

Even before Sigma's implantation, Maine was not a good person. He had admirable traits, sure, but if I were to draw a comparison to other fictional characters when describing the Meta, Venom from Marvel Comics, Gollum from LOTR, and a general comparison to a crack addict. It's an addiction that corrupted what little good was in him, the AI were demons in his ear whispering words of encouragement for every act of treason and murder he committed, celebrating every ally, friend, and innocent he strikes down in his pursuit of power
